Calculating the Days: A Step-by-Step Approach
The number of days until January 28th obviously depends on the current date. There isn't a single definitive answer. To calculate this accurately, you'll need to know the current date. While you can use a simple online calculator or a calendar application for a quick answer, understanding the underlying calculation can be helpful.
Manual Calculation Method:
-
Identify the Current Date: Note down the current month, day, and year.
-
Determine the Remaining Days in the Current Month: Count the days remaining in the current month from the current day.
-
Calculate Days in Subsequent Months: Add the number of days in each subsequent month until you reach December.
-
Add Days in January: Add the number of days in January until January 28th.
-
Total: Sum all the calculated days from steps 2, 3, and 4. This gives you the total number of days until January 28th.
This method is time-consuming, especially if January 28th is far off. For a more efficient calculation, online tools or calendar apps are highly recommended.

1. Goal Setting and Task Breakdown:
- Define your objectives: What needs to be accomplished by January 28th? Be specific. Instead of "finish the project," specify what constitutes "finished." Is it a completed report, a finished presentation, or a fully functional software application?
- Break down large tasks: Divide your main objective into smaller, manageable tasks. This makes the overall goal less daunting and facilitates progress tracking.
- Prioritize tasks: Determine which tasks are most critical and tackle them first. Consider using prioritization techniques like Eisenhower Matrix (urgent/important) to optimize your workflow.
- Set realistic deadlines: Assign deadlines to each sub-task, ensuring they are attainable and contribute to the final January 28th deadline. Avoid over-scheduling; allow for buffer time in case of unexpected delays.
2. Time Management Techniques for Success:
- Time Blocking: Allocate specific time blocks in your schedule for working on each task. This helps maintain focus and prevents task-switching.
- Pomodoro Technique: Work in focused bursts (e.g., 25 minutes) followed by short breaks. This technique enhances concentration and prevents burnout.
- Eliminate Distractions: Minimize interruptions during your focused work sessions. Turn off notifications, close unnecessary tabs, and find a quiet workspace.
- Regular Review and Adjustment: Periodically review your progress, identify bottlenecks, and adjust your schedule as needed. Flexibility is key to adapting to unforeseen circumstances.
3. Utilizing Technology for Time Management:
- To-Do List Apps: Use apps like Todoist, Any.do, or Microsoft To Do to create, organize, and track your tasks. These apps often provide features like task prioritization, reminders, and progress tracking.
- Calendar Apps: Integrate your tasks into a calendar app (Google Calendar, Outlook Calendar) to visualize your schedule and deadlines. This provides a visual representation of your progress and impending deadlines.
- Project Management Software: For complex projects, consider using project management software like Asana, Trello, or Monday.com. These tools facilitate collaboration, task assignment, and progress monitoring.
4. Stress Management and Well-being:
- Regular Breaks: Schedule regular breaks to avoid burnout. Step away from your work, stretch, walk around, or engage in a relaxing activity.
- Prioritize Sleep: Ensure you get sufficient sleep to maintain focus and productivity. Lack of sleep can significantly impair cognitive function.
- Mindfulness and Meditation: Practice mindfulness or meditation techniques to manage stress and enhance focus. Even short meditation sessions can make a significant difference.
- Healthy Lifestyle: Maintain a healthy lifestyle through regular exercise, a balanced diet, and sufficient hydration. These factors contribute to overall well-being and enhance productivity.
